In this book, the importance of the historical background of Nagas in general and the Sumi Naga, in particular, is shown. Beliefs and practices play an important role in making the Naga life complete) and they are also associated with all their activities. Namely, 'genas' are observed during hunting, fishing, disposing of dead bodies, divorce, etc. Nagas have a strong conception of human soul and the existence of 'village of the dead form the foundation of their moral codes.
